    I have a spline with a cloner that clones some spheres along the spline. I want to start from 0 clones from one end of the spline and have it fill the clones to the other end of the line totally 31 clones. so im animating from 0-31 clones over time. The clones seem to be starting to animate from the center of the spline for some reason.

    Thanks Brian I didn’t know you could put a spline wrap in a null with a cloner and it automatically uses the splinewrap as the “object” even though you are using “linear” setting of the clone. I was using the cloner”object” mode and used the spline as the object which worked except for the whole clones starting from the middle of the spline.

    This is pretty confusing but now I know.

    one other thing I have the cloned spheres turn on the spline at a 90 degree angle and at that corner point the sphere’s are warped. anyone know how to fix this?
